If you have a broken drawstring in your pants or sweatpants, you may be wondering how to reinsert it. Fortunately, there are several different ways to do this.

One of the easiest ways is to use a safety pin. This will not only get the drawstring out of your clothes, but will also help you thread it back in.

Another way is to try knotting the end of the drawstring. This will prevent it from getting pulled out of the hole in the waistband of your pants.

For other options, you can try a paper clip or a crochet hook. These can be a bit more difficult to use, but they do work. However, you will still have to thread the replacement string through the hole in the casing.

When you are doing this, you need to make sure that you get the biggest safety pin possible. Your biggest pin should be at least two inches long. The safety pin will then feed through the channel in your pants and hold the drawstring in place.

How Do You Restring a Drawstring?

Using a safety pin is an easy way to restring drawstring pants. You can also use a pen cap, straw, or paperclip. If you don’t have any of these items, you may be able to buy them at a fabric store.

The first step is to thread the safety pin through the opening. Make sure the safety pin is as large as possible. This will help it slide through the channel in the casing.

Once the safety pin is inside the hole, pull the other end out. If your pants are made from a heavy material, it can be a challenge to feel through it. Use the straw to push the safety pin through the material.
